A map of the contiguous United States that shows phrases used on Twitter whose increased usage contribute the most to that state's 'calories in' and 'calories out' differing from the overall averages of these measures. For example, tweets from Vermont, which was above average for both calories in and calories out, disproportionately contain "bacon" and "skiing." Michigan was above average for calories in and below for calories out. Its most distinguishing phrases are "chocolate candy" and "laying down."
